Spark Test

  1. Disconnect the Injector Extension Connector (A).
    G12786861Courtesy of HYUNDAI MOTOR AMERICA
  2. Disconnect the Ignition Coil Connector (A).
    G12786862Courtesy of HYUNDAI MOTOR AMERICA
    NOTE:
    • When removing the Ignition Coil Connector, pull the lock pin (A) and push the clip (B).
    G12786863Courtesy of HYUNDAI MOTOR AMERICA
  3. Remove the Ignition Coil (A).
    G12786864Courtesy of HYUNDAI MOTOR AMERICA
  4. Using a spark plug wrench, remove the spark plug (A).
    NOTE:
    • Be careful that no contaminates enter into spark plug holes.
  5. Insert the spark plug on the ignition coil.
  6. Ground the spark plug to the engine.
    G12786865Courtesy of HYUNDAI MOTOR AMERICA
    NOTE:
    • Do Not crank the engine for more than 5~10 seconds.
  7. Check all the spark plugs.
  8. Using a spark plug wrench, install the spark plug.

    Tightening Torque: 

    14.7 ~ 24.5 N.m (1.5 ~ 2.5 kgf.m, 10.8 ~ 18.0 Ib-ft)

  9. Install the ignition coil.

    Tightening Torque: 

    9.8 ~ 11.8 N.m (1.0 ~ 1.2 kgf.m, 7.2 ~ 8.7 Ib-ft)

  10. Connect the ignition coil connector.
  11. Connect the injector connector.
